Indian naval commander K.M. Nanavati returns home from the line of duty, only to find that his wife Sylvia Nanavati is having an extra-marital affair...

    Naval officer Kawas Nanavati commits a gruesome murder with his service revolver in broad daylight. For the Indian Navy, Nanavati is a hero. The prosecution and the defendant are set to fight this seemingly open and shut case that makes headlines and scandalizes the entire nation.

    Chandu Trivedi reluctantly accepts assistance from Sindhi lawyer Ram Jethmalani. Before the first hearing, the prosecution and the defense must select the jury members. Both Trivedi and Khandalawala try to select members who will take the final verdict in favour of their candidate.

    Honourable Judge R.B Mehta is shocked at the jury’s verdict in favour of Kawas Nanavati. He is forced to exercise his judicial powers and nullify the judgement passed by the jury. He refers the case to the High Court. Meanwhile, Rusie Karanjia unites the entire Parsi community and convinces them to campaign for mercy petition for Kawas.
